Vapor Barrier Installation in Fort Wayne, IN
Vapor barrier installation is a service that involves placing a moisture-resistant barrier beneath floors, in crawl spaces, or within basements to prevent moisture from seeping into the living areas. This process is commonly used in residential projects to improve indoor air quality, prevent mold growth, and protect structural elements from water damage. Property owners often request vapor barriers when preparing a space for renovation, addressing existing moisture issues, or ensuring long-term durability of foundations and flooring.
Before requesting vapor barrier installation, homeowners should consider the specific areas that need protection and the type of vapor barrier best suited for their property. It is important to understand the condition of the subfloor or crawl space, as well as any existing moisture problems, to determine the most effective solution. Proper installation can help maintain a healthier indoor environment and safeguard the property against future moisture-related issues.

Common Vapor Barrier Installation Jobs
Basement projects - vapor barriers help control moisture and prevent mold growth.
Crawl space sealing - installation reduces humidity and improves indoor air quality.
Attic insulation - vapor barriers protect insulation from moisture damage.
New construction - vapor barriers are integrated to ensure a dry, stable building envelope.
Retrofitting - existing structures can benefit from vapor barrier upgrades for better moisture control.
Garage conversions - vapor barriers help maintain a dry environment during and after renovation.
Vapor Barrier Installation Questions
What is a vapor barrier? A vapor barrier is a material installed to prevent moisture from passing through walls, floors, or ceilings, helping to control humidity and prevent mold growth.
Where are vapor barriers typically installed? They are commonly installed in basements, crawl spaces, and underneath concrete slabs to reduce moisture intrusion.
What types of materials are used for vapor barriers? Common materials include polyethylene sheets, foil-backed membranes, and other plastic sheeting designed for moisture control.
Why is vapor barrier installation important? Proper installation helps maintain a dry environment, protects building structures, and improves indoor air quality.
